What Causes This Problem
- Smoke damage from residential or commercial fires often contaminates belongings.
- Water intrusion during floods can ruin fabric, paper, and electronics.
- Mold growth can develop on damp personal property if untreated.
- Fire extinguisher chemicals may leave residues on furniture and decor.
- Improper storage conditions can lead to dust and grime buildup.
Erie’s varied climate, including frequent snow melts affecting basements near Coal Creek, contributes to damage risks for personal items. Service Cost In Erie, CO
Contents cleaning and restoration costs in Erie typically range from $500 to $3,000 depending on the extent of damage, types of items, and necessary treatment methods.

What Types Of Items Can Be Restored With This Service?
Most fabric, wood, electronics, documents, and decorative items can be restored, depending on damage severity and material type.
How Long Does Contents Cleaning & Restoration Typically Take?
The timeline varies by damage extent, but most restorations are completed within several days to a couple of weeks.
Is Contents Cleaning Safe For Delicate Or Antique Belongings?
Yes, technicians tailor cleaning methods to suit sensitive materials, using gentle and specialized treatments.
Do Insurance Companies Cover Contents Cleaning & Restoration Costs?
Often, insurance policies cover these services, but coverage depends on your specific policy and incident type.
